Clinical Reasoning and Prioritization
When assessing a newborn at risk for hypoglycemia, the nurse must integrate both the clinical presentation and the numerical blood glucose value to determine the urgency of intervention. While all options present signs that could be associated with low blood glucose, the combination of specific neurological symptoms and a critically low glucose level dictates the priority.
Analyzing the Assessment Findings
The most critical indicator is the presence of
neuroglycopenic signs—symptoms resulting from the brain's deprivation of glucose—coupled with a blood glucose level that falls below established treatment thresholds. According to a systematic review of international guidelines, severe hypoglycemia, defined as a blood glucose level
< 36 mg/dL (2 mmol/L), poses a direct risk of neurological injury and developmental delays
[4]. The finding of
jitteriness and tremors represents overt neurological irritability, a clear manifestation of this central nervous system fuel deficiency .
In option 1, the blood glucose of
35 mg/dL is below the critical threshold of 36 mg/dL identified in the literature for potential brain injury, and it is accompanied by unmistakable neuroglycopenic signs
[4]. This combination requires immediate intervention, typically with buccal dextrose gel or intravenous glucose, to prevent progression to more severe symptoms like lethargy or seizures.
Differentiating the Other Options
The other options, while concerning, do not represent the same level of immediate danger. Sleepiness and poor feeding (option 2) with a glucose of
45 mg/dL are common, non-specific signs of hypoglycemia that warrant prompt feeding and rechecking but are not a medical emergency in the same way as active neurological signs. Mild irritability (option 3) with a glucose of
50 mg/dL is a very mild presentation with a value that is above the typical operational threshold for treatment in many guidelines, where a value of 50-60 mg/dL is often a target range prior to feeding . A weak cry and lethargy (option 4) are late and ominous signs of a depleted central nervous system, but the associated glucose of
55 mg/dL is less consistent with a pure hypoglycemic cause and could indicate another underlying pathology such as sepsis; this would require investigation, but the immediate, life-saving intervention tied directly to the glucose value is less clear than in option 1. The clinical guideline synthesis indicates that management algorithms are driven by the combination of the measured blood glucose value and the presence or absence of abnormal clinical signs, with symptomatic hypoglycemia at any severe level requiring the most urgent escalation .
